Skip to content
体验新版
项目
组织
正在加载...
登录
切换导航
打开侧边栏
Achou.Wang
accel-ppp
提交
8fb4294d
A
accel-ppp
项目概览
Achou.Wang
/
accel-ppp
通知
6
Star
1
Fork
0
代码
文件
提交
分支
Tags
贡献者
分支图
Diff
Issue
0
列表
看板
标记
里程碑
合并请求
0
Wiki
0
Wiki
分析
仓库
DevOps
项目成员
Pages
A
accel-ppp
项目概览
项目概览
详情
发布
仓库
仓库
文件
提交
分支
标签
贡献者
分支图
比较
Issue
0
Issue
0
列表
看板
标记
里程碑
合并请求
0
合并请求
0
Pages
分析
分析
仓库分析
DevOps
Wiki
0
Wiki
成员
成员
收起侧边栏
关闭侧边栏
动态
分支图
创建新Issue
提交
Issue看板
前往新版Gitcode,体验更适合开发者的 AI 搜索 >>
提交
8fb4294d
编写于
12月 09, 2010
作者:
D
Dmitry Kozlov
浏览文件
操作
浏览文件
下载
电子邮件补丁
差异文件
1.3.1 release
上级
0ad1e3d8
变更
8
隐藏空白更改
内联
并排
Showing
8 changed file
with
10 addition
and
29 deletion
+10
-29
README
README
+1
-1
accel-pptpd/CMakeLists.txt
accel-pptpd/CMakeLists.txt
+1
-1
cmake/cpack.cmake
cmake/cpack.cmake
+2
-6
cmake/debian.cmake
cmake/debian.cmake
+0
-5
cmake/debian/debian.cmake
cmake/debian/debian.cmake
+4
-4
cmake/debian/postinst
cmake/debian/postinst
+1
-4
cmake/debian/preinst
cmake/debian/preinst
+0
-7
contrib/debian/accel-pptp-init
contrib/debian/accel-pptp-init
+1
-1
未找到文件。
README
浏览文件 @
8fb4294d
...
...
@@ -39,7 +39,7 @@ Compilation and instalation
-----------
Make sure you have configured kernel headers in /usr/src/linux,
or specify other location via KDIR.
1. cd /path/to/accel-pptp-1.3.
0
1. cd /path/to/accel-pptp-1.3.
1
2. mkdir build
3. cd build
4. cmake [-DBUILD_DRIVER=FALSE] [-DKDIR=/usr/src/linux] [-DCMAKE_INSTALL_PREFIX=/usr/local] [-DCMAKE_BUILD_TYPE=Release] [-DLOG_PGSQL=FALSE] [-DSHAPER=FALSE] [-DRADIUS=TRUE] ..
...
...
accel-pptpd/CMakeLists.txt
浏览文件 @
8fb4294d
...
...
@@ -23,7 +23,7 @@ IF (EXISTS ${CMAKE_HOME_DIRECTORY}/.git)
)
STRING
(
STRIP
${
ACCEL_PPTP_VERSION
}
ACCEL_PPTP_VERSION
)
ELSE
(
EXISTS
${
CMAKE_HOME_DIRECTORY
}
/.git
)
SET
(
ACCEL_PPTP_VERSION
${
CMAKE_HOME_DIRECTORY
}
/
"1.3.0"
)
SET
(
ACCEL_PPTP_VERSION
1.3.1
)
ENDIF
(
EXISTS
${
CMAKE_HOME_DIRECTORY
}
/.git
)
ADD_DEFINITIONS
(
-DACCEL_PPTP_VERSION=
"
${
ACCEL_PPTP_VERSION
}
"
)
...
...
cmake/cpack.cmake
浏览文件 @
8fb4294d
INCLUDE
(
InstallRequiredSystemLibraries
)
SET
(
CPACK_PACKAGE_VERSION_MAJOR
"1"
)
SET
(
CPACK_PACKAGE_VERSION_MINOR
"
1
"
)
SET
(
CPACK_PACKAGE_VERSION_PATCH
"
2
"
)
SET
(
CPACK_PACKAGE_VERSION_MINOR
"
3
"
)
SET
(
CPACK_PACKAGE_VERSION_PATCH
"
1
"
)
SET
(
CPACK_PACKAGE_NAME
"accel-pptp"
)
#SET(CPACK_PACKAGE_VERSION "1.1.2")
SET
(
CPACK_PACKAGE_CONTACT
"Dmitry Kozlov <xeb@mail.ru>"
)
SET
(
CPACK_PACKAGE_DESCRIPTION_SUMMARY
"High-performance multi-protocol tunneling server for Linux"
)
SET
(
CPACK_PACKAGE_VENDOR
"Dmitry Kozlov"
)
SET
(
CPACK_PACKAGE_DESCRIPTION_FILE
"
${
CMAKE_CURRENT_SOURCE_DIR
}
/README"
)
SET
(
CPACK_RESOURCE_FILE_LICENSE
"
${
CMAKE_CURRENT_SOURCE_DIR
}
/COPYING"
)
...
...
@@ -23,4 +20,3 @@ IF(CMAKE_BUILD_TYPE STREQUAL Debian)
ENDIF
(
CMAKE_BUILD_TYPE STREQUAL Debian
)
INCLUDE
(
CPack
)
cmake/debian.cmake
已删除
100644 → 0
浏览文件 @
0ad1e3d8
SET
(
CPACK_DEBIAN_PACKAGE_ARCHITECTURE $ARCH
)
SET
(
CPACK_DEBIAN_PACKAGE_DEPENDS libc6 libssl
)
SET
(
CPACK_DEBIAN_PACKAGE_CONTROL_EXTRA
"
${
CMAKE_CURRENT_SOURCE_DIR
}
/cmake/debian/postinst;
${
CMAKE_CURRENT_SOURCE_DIR
}
/cmake/debian/preinst"
)
cmake/debian/debian.cmake
浏览文件 @
8fb4294d
...
...
@@ -7,11 +7,11 @@ if (BUILD_DRIVER_ONLY)
SET
(
CPACK_DEBIAN_PACKAGE_CONTROL_EXTRA
"
${
CMAKE_CURRENT_SOURCE_DIR
}
/cmake/debian-kmod/postinst"
)
INSTALL
(
FILES
${
CMAKE_CURRENT_BINARY_DIR
}
/driver/driver/pptp.ko DESTINATION lib/modules/
${
DEBIAN_KDIR
}
/extra
)
#SET(CPACK_DEBIAN_PACKAGE_DEPENDS "linux-image (= ${LINUX_IMAGE})")
else
(
BUILD_DRIVER_ONLY
)
SET
(
CPACK_DEBIAN_PACKAGE_DEPENDS
"libc6 (>= 2.7), libssl0.9.8 (>= 0.9.8)"
)
SET
(
CPACK_DEBIAN_PACKAGE_CONTROL_EXTRA
"
${
CMAKE_CURRENT_SOURCE_DIR
}
/cmake/debian/p
reinst;
${
CMAKE_CURRENT_SOURCE_DIR
}
/cmake/debian/p
ostinst"
)
else
(
BUILD_DRIVER_ONLY
)
SET
(
CPACK_DEBIAN_PACKAGE_DEPENDS
"libc6 (>= 2.7), libssl0.9.8 (>= 0.9.8)
, libpcre3 (>= 7.6)
"
)
SET
(
CPACK_DEBIAN_PACKAGE_CONTROL_EXTRA
"
${
CMAKE_CURRENT_SOURCE_DIR
}
/cmake/debian/postinst"
)
INSTALL
(
FILES
${
CMAKE_HOME_DIRECTORY
}
/accel-pptpd/accel-pptp.conf DESTINATION etc RENAME accel-pptp.conf.dist
)
INSTALL
(
FILES
${
CMAKE_HOME_DIRECTORY
}
/contrib/debian/accel-pptp-init DESTINATION etc/init.d RENAME accel-pptp
)
INSTALL
(
FILES
${
CMAKE_HOME_DIRECTORY
}
/contrib/debian/accel-pptp-default DESTINATION etc/default RENAME accel-pptp
)
endif
(
BUILD_DRIVER_ONLY
)
cmake/debian/postinst
浏览文件 @
8fb4294d
...
...
@@ -3,9 +3,6 @@
chmod
+x /etc/init.d/accel-pptp
mkdir
/var/log/accel-pptp &> /dev/null
if
[
-f
/tmp/__accel-pptp.conf
]
;
then
mv
/tmp/__accel-pptp.conf /etc/accel-pptp.conf
fi
mkdir
/var/run/accel-pptp &> /dev/null
exit
0
cmake/debian/preinst
已删除
100755 → 0
浏览文件 @
0ad1e3d8
#!/bin/sh
if
[
-f
/etc/accel-pptp.conf
]
;
then
mv
/etc/accel-pptp.conf /tmp/__accel-pptp.conf
fi
exit
0
contrib/debian/accel-pptp-init
浏览文件 @
8fb4294d
...
...
@@ -14,7 +14,7 @@ PATH=/bin:/usr/bin:/sbin:/usr/sbin
.
/lib/lsb/init-functions
if
test
-f
/et
с
/default/accel-pptp
;
then
if
test
-f
/et
c
/default/accel-pptp
;
then
.
/etc/default/accel-pptp
fi
...
...
编辑
预览
Markdown
is supported
0%
请重试
或
添加新附件
.
添加附件
取消
You are about to add
0
people
to the discussion. Proceed with caution.
先完成此消息的编辑!
取消
想要评论请
注册
或
登录